-DATE- 19881107 -YEAR- 1988 -DOCUMENT_TYPE- APPEARANCE -AUTHOR- F.CASTRO -HEADLINE- CASTRO TOURS CONSTRUCTION SITE -PLACE- EXPO-CUBA SITE -SOURCE- HAVANA TELE-REBELDE -REPORT_NBR- FBIS -REPORT_DATE- 19881108 -TEXT- Tours Construction Site FL0711154888 Havana Television Tele-Rebelde Network in Spanish 1200 GMT 7 Nov 88 [Text] Commander in Chief Fidel Castro Ruz, first secretary of the PCC Central Committee and president of the Councils of State and Ministers, visited the Expo-Cuba site where 4,000 construction workers were carrying out their volunteer day this Red Sunday. Fidel chatted with the workers, the majority of whom were working on the central pavilion. He also expressed interest in the progress of various other areas and access routes to the installation which is scheduled to be completed on 31 December in salute to the 30th anniversary of the triumph of the revolution. The following members of the PCC Central Committee were also present at the site: Jorge Lezcano, first secretary of the provincial committee of the part in Havana City; Pedro Chavez, president of the Provincial Assembly of the People's Government; and other leaders of the Central Organization of Cuban Trade Unions in the capital. -END-
